ir Rescue Systems Corp. (ARS) is proud to announce the air worthiness approvals for the ARV-QC (Air Rescue Vest- Quick Connect) rescue device by the US Army, Navy and Marine Corp. These approvals capped a long testing and substantiation process by the respective branches of the military. Approval for the US Army Medevac program includes use on both the UH/HH-60 and UH-72 aircraft.

The ARV-QC is a one size fits all rescue device capable of securely hoisting persons from

35-400 Ibs. (16-182 kg). The ARV-QC incorporates all new, advanced lightweight multi-composite materials that significantly reduces over-all system weight but increases device strength resulting in an MBS of 4000 lbs. Utilizing a highly engineered state-of-the art-pivoting "Key-Lock Lift" system, the device increases safety by eliminating additional hardware to lock and secure the victim in place. Available in Bright "Rescue" and "Military" Tan.

Purpose-designed and built by working helicopter operations professionals the ARV-QC provides the benefits of full body capture with the speed of a rescue strop. The ARV-QC was created from the need for a safe, comfortable, and secure full body rescue device.
